OverviewSince its launch in 1993 with a collection of six essential handbags, Kate Spade New York has always been colorful, bold, and optimistic. Today, it is a global lifestyle brand that designs extraordinary things for the everyday, delivering seasonal collections of handbags, ready-to-wear, jewelry, footwear, home décor, and more. Known for its rich heritage and unique brand DNA, Kate Spade New York offers a distinctive point of view and celebrates communities of women around the globe who live their perfectly imperfect lifestyles.
EssentialDuties And Responsibilities
- Client & service expert: achieves individual sales goals; develops strong product knowledge across all categories; the sales associate is responsible for ensuring exemplary customer service by delivering the ultimate kate spade experience; able to develop a personal clientele through effective use of the selling skills, proactive client outreach and use of client book.
- Building Brand Equity: understand and communicate the kate spade aesthetic, brand philosophy and lifestyle to the customer; demonstrate interest and ability to work as part of a team.
- Operational Excellence: execute operational tasks as per company directives; accurately processes all pos transactions; adhere to and apply visual directives, ensure that store standards are executed daily.
- Physical Requirements:
available to work store schedule, as needed, including evenings and weekends; standing for extended periods of time; able to safely lift boxes up to 40 pounds; comfortable climbing ladders.
Required
- Professional selling skills and exceptional interpersonal skills.
- Prior Luxury Goods Experience Preferred.
- Proactive ability to multi-task and prioritize; works well in a team environment; college degree preferred.
